Lyceum Ban Funkadelic
uncredited writer, Melody Maker, 3 April 1971
FUNKADELIC, THE American group banned by London's Royal Albert Hall, have now been banned from the Strand Lyceum. Promoter John Sullivan — offered Funkadelic by the American Program Bureau — had originally planned to present the group at the Albert Hall on May 11. When the Albert Hall management said no — as exclusively revealed in the MM on March 20 — John Sullivan switched the date to May 9 — this time at the London Lyceum.
